A line segment connecting any two opposite Vertex of a quadrilateral​
Wewaii [24]

Answer:

As applied to a polygon, a diagonal is a line segment joining any two non-consecutive vertices. Therefore, a quadrilateral has two diagonals, joining opposite pairs of vertices. For any convex polygon, all the diagonals are inside the polygon, but for re-entrant polygons, some diagonals are outside of the polygon.

Solve 5c − c + 10 = 34. <br> −6 <br> 6 <br> 11 <br> −11
natima [27]

Subtract 10 and collect terms to get the variable term by itself on the left.

... 4c = 24

Divide by the coefficient of the variable, 4.

... c = 6

The appropriate choice is the second one:

... 6

_____

You don't actually have to sove the equation to find the right answer. You just need to see which answer works.

-6: 5(-6) -(-6) +10 = -14 ≠ 34

6: 5(6) -(6) +10 = 34 . . . . . . . this answer works (you can stop here)

11: 5(11) -(11) +10 = 54 ≠ 34

-11: 5(-11) -(-11) +10 = -34 ≠ 34
